Robinsons are delighted to offer to the market this excellent opportunity to acquire this good sized two bedroom mid terraced family home, which in our opinion should suit a variety of purchasers from the first time buyer to property investor. This comfortable home is conveniently located for near by shops and Ferryhill market place which lies approximately 1/2 a mile away and the property has been well maintained over recent years by the current owners. Viewing is essential to appreciate the accommodation on offer and the property benefits from UPVC DOUBLE GLAZING AND GAS CENTRAL HEATING.

Briefly comprising of; ENTRANCE, hallway, open plan lounge/dining room, fitted kitchen. Whilst to the first floor there is two well proportioned bedrooms with master having the added bonus of fitted wardrobes and attractive fitted bathroom. EXTERNALLY to the rear there is a easy to maintain enclosed yard.

Hallway - Stairs to first floor.

Lounge - 3.53m x 3.20m max points (11'7 x 10'6 max points) - UPVC window, radiator.

Dining Room - 3.66m x 3.28m max points (12'0 x 10'9 max points) - UPVC window, radiator.

Kitchen - 2.62m x 2.21m (8'7 x 7'3 ) - Wall and base units, stainless steel sink with mixer tap and drainer, tiled splashbakcs, radiator, uPVC window, electric cooker point, space for fridge freezer, tiled flooring.

Landing - Loft access.

Bedroom One - 3.89m x 3.20m max points (12'9 x 10'6 max points) - UPVC window, radiator, fitted wardrobe.

Bedroom Two - 3.51m x 2.84m max points (11'6 x 9'4 max points) - UPVC window, radiator.

Bathroom - 2.62m x 2.46m (8'7 x 8'1 ) - Panelled bath, shower cubicle, wash hand basin, W/C, tiled flooring, uPVC window, radiator.

Externally - To the rear is an enclosed yard.

Spennymoor local information A town in County Durham, Spennymoor was founded in the 1850s and stands above the Wear Valley. Some of the most notable landmarks of the town include Whitworth Hall, a famous estate well known for its inclusion in the nursery rhyme “Bobby Shafto’s gone to Sea”. It is now a site for a well-farmed deer park, which is enclosed by a walled garden.  Spennymoor Settlement is a centre for the fine arts, with drama and music events regularly appearing in the building, amongst other community events. There are also plans for a brand new Regional Arts Centre.  The local football team is Spennymoor Town F.C and the leisure centre includes the local swimming pool, which offers swimming lessons, football coaching, martial arts tutoring, tennis lessons, badminton practice, a gymnasium and gymnastic workouts. The site is also home to a modern Regional Gymnasium Centre, made possible by a portion of funding from the National Lottery and Sport England.
